Technology Innovation Institute (TII) is a publicly funded research institute, based in Abu Dhabi, United Arab Emirates. It is home to a diverse community of leading scientists, engineers, mathematicians, and researchers from across the globe, transforming problems and roadblocks into pioneering research and technology prototypes that help move society ahead.Autonomous Robotics Research Centre Unmanned vehicles in space, in the air, on land, on sea, and underwater offer exciting opportunities to dramatically improve safety, environmental protection and operational effectiveness – at lower cost – in both industrial and mission-critical settings.Our research focus includes: UAV research and development, covering platforms, real-time operating systems, perception and communication algorithms, control, and decision-making algorithms Autonomous marine and submarine vehicles research and development for different use cases Autonomous ground vehicle research and development for on road and off-road use cases Swarm architectures for heterogeneous drones and advanced communication networks Low-power platforms for nano-size and pico-size UAV classes Bio-inspired, evolutionary, and self-organized methodologies We are looking for a Perception Engineer to join our GROUND Robotics team at the Autonomous Robotics Research Center. In this role, you will help evolve and extend our perception stack by applying both traditional computer vision techniques and deep learning methods.While the role is geared more toward end-to-end deep learning approaches, the ideal candidate should also have experience with traditional perception systems. Your work will contribute to real-time, deployable systems for autonomous a variety of applications in on-road and off-road navigation across diverse robotics platforms.Responsibilities Design and implement robust, real-time perception modules for structured on-road and unstructured off-road environments using both learning-based and geometric approaches.Develop clean, modular, and efficient code in C++ and Python, following ROS1/ROS2 and industry best practices.Perform rigorous field testing and iterative tuning to ensure reliability under challenging real-world conditions.Collaborate closely with teams across localization, planning, and control for seamless system integration.Contribute to code reviews and maintain detailed technical documentation for system components.Integrate HDMap data (e.g., Lanelet2, custom semantic layers) into the perception pipeline to support object-level reasoning, localization, and terrain adaptation.Requirements4+ years of experience in real-time perception or computer vision systems.Proficiency in using tools and libraries such as Open CV, PCL, Open3D, Py Torch and Tensor RT.Solid understanding of deep learning architectures, including CNNs, transformers, and their applications in perception.Familiarity with modern perception methods such as LSS, BEVFormer, BEVFusion, etc., with the ability to reason about trade-offs between accuracy, latency, and deployment constraints.Strong programming skills in Python and C++, with experience in ROS1 or ROS2-based systems.Experience using modern development tools and workflows (e.g., Git, Docker, Jenkins).Comfortable working with traditional perception techniques, alongside deep learning-based methods.Familiarity with experiment management tools like Hydra, Weights & Biases, AWS Sage Maker and GCP.Familiarity with HDMap frameworks such as Lanelet2, TOMTOM, etc.Hands-on experience with ARM64-based edge devices such as the NVIDIA Jetson family Strong communication skills, capable of effectively explaining complex idea.Able to work independently and as part of a fast-paced, mission-driven team.Able to pivot between experimental prototyping and debugging practical system-level issues.Qualifications Bachelor's or Master's degree in Robotics, Computer Vision, or a related field.At TII, we help society to overcome its biggest hurdles through a rigorous approach to scientific discovery and inquiry, using state-of-the-art facilities and collaboration with leading international institutions.
